Are you familiar with using github server and CLI to checkout specific branches and pushing into a github repo? (there are excellent tutorials on this).
In fact, you can create your own fork of sagemath on github and practice there. Our workflow is similar, except that it has a much cruder web interface. There is also a description on this in our development manual, but it is a bit too terse. On Thu, 30 Jan 2020, 15:16 Vipul Gupta, <vipul.gupta73...@gmail.com> wrote: > Can someone help me with guidelines to make contribution using only git? > Regards > Vipul Gupta > > On Thu, 30 Jan, 2020, 7:45 pm Dima Pasechnik, <dimp...@gmail.com> wrote: > >> I think git-trac should not be mentioned in the manual as the preferred >> way to use git. >> >> Imho the majority of devs here use plain git... >> >> On Thu, 30 Jan 2020, 14:07 David Roe, <roed.m...@gmail.com> wrote: >> >>> >>> >>> On Thu, Jan 30, 2020 at 7:35 AM Simon King <simon.k...@uni-jena.de> >>> wrote: >>> >>>> Hi Eric, >>>> >>>> On 2020-01-30, Eric Gourgoulhon <egourgoul...@gmail.com> wrote: >>>> > I would even vote for removing the git-trac section from the >>>> developer >>>> > manual. >>>> >>>> -1 >>>> >>>> I do use "git trac". >>>> >>> >>> Agreed. I would absolutely not advocate removing git-trac from the >>> manual. I find that it makes some tasks easier than using plain git. >>> >>> For the original poster, what problems are you having with git-trac? >>> David >>> >>> >>>> Best regards, >>>> Simon >>>> >>>> -- >>>> You received this message because you are subscribed to the Google >>>> Groups "sage-devel" group. >>>> To unsubscribe from this group and stop receiving emails from it, send >>>> an email to sage-devel+unsubscr...@googlegroups.com. >>>> To view this discussion on the web visit >>>> https://groups.google.com/d/msgid/sage-devel/r0uihu%24c5e%241%40ciao.gmane.io >>>> . >>>> >>> -- >>> You received this message because you are subscribed to the Google >>> Groups "sage-devel" group. >>> To unsubscribe from this group and stop receiving emails from it, send >>> an email to sage-devel+unsubscr...@googlegroups.com. >>> To view this discussion on the web visit >>> https://groups.google.com/d/msgid/sage-devel/CAChs6_nMkQC4-0sP%2BZd9E6K39kx42ZZ%3DZQ%2BM%2B3MN0yx5Svcz%2Bw%40mail.gmail.com >>> <https://groups.google.com/d/msgid/sage-devel/CAChs6_nMkQC4-0sP%2BZd9E6K39kx42ZZ%3DZQ%2BM%2B3MN0yx5Svcz%2Bw%40mail.gmail.com?utm_medium=email&utm_source=footer> >>> . >>> >> -- >> You received this message because you are subscribed to the Google Groups >> "sage-devel" group. >> To unsubscribe from this group and stop receiving emails from it, send an >> email to sage-devel+unsubscr...@googlegroups.com. >> To view this discussion on the web visit >> https://groups.google.com/d/msgid/sage-devel/CAAWYfq39FWD7rG0K8i09NT_R4aYuj554OFDHfGbJ_zH0sHGM4Q%40mail.gmail.com >> <https://groups.google.com/d/msgid/sage-devel/CAAWYfq39FWD7rG0K8i09NT_R4aYuj554OFDHfGbJ_zH0sHGM4Q%40mail.gmail.com?utm_medium=email&utm_source=footer> >> . >> > -- > You received this message because you are subscribed to the Google Groups > "sage-devel" group. > To unsubscribe from this group and stop receiving emails from it, send an > email to sage-devel+unsubscr...@googlegroups.com. > To view this discussion on the web visit > https://groups.google.com/d/msgid/sage-devel/CA%2BSFJRcQAti7EX%3D-BO9mMYVXdLtUSiJP%2BoB%3DfW0HVJ476Z%2Bejw%40mail.gmail.com > <https://groups.google.com/d/msgid/sage-devel/CA%2BSFJRcQAti7EX%3D-BO9mMYVXdLtUSiJP%2BoB%3DfW0HVJ476Z%2Bejw%40mail.gmail.com?utm_medium=email&utm_source=footer> > . > -- You received this message because you are subscribed to the Google Groups "sage-devel" group. To unsubscribe from this group and stop receiving emails from it, send an email to sage-devel+unsubscr...@googlegroups.com. To view this discussion on the web visit https://groups.google.com/d/msgid/sage-devel/CAAWYfq2L%2B9bxsj__0NoQMhqU9oO7wJAR9K0KHtQ1yq7hjq%3DQ7Q%40mail.gmail.com.